The Challenge
Hospitals in Nigeria often struggle with:
-
Frequent power outages disrupting critical operations.
-
High dependency on diesel generators, leading to soaring costs.
-
Lack of automation, making it hard to monitor and optimize energy use.
The hospital needed a system that could ensure uninterrupted power, lower costs, and improve energy efficiency — without sacrificing reliability.
The DOT MATRIX Solution
Our engineers designed and deployed a Smart Hybrid Power System built on three pillars:
-
Sustainable Power Supply
-
Integrated solar panels and battery storage with existing grid and backup generators.
-
Reduced diesel usage by 40% within the first three months.
-
-
Automation & Control Systems
-
Custom-programmed PLC (Programmable Logic Controllers) for seamless switching between power sources.
-
Real-time monitoring through SCADA dashboards accessible to facility managers.
-
-
Predictive Insights & Efficiency
-
IoT sensors track energy consumption across departments.
-
AI-powered analytics predict peak demand and optimize resource allocation.

The Impact
-
Cost Savings: 30% reduction in operational energy costs.
-
Reliability: 24/7 uninterrupted power supply for critical units.
-
Sustainability: Significant reduction in carbon emissions through lower generator usage.
-
Scalability: System designed for future expansion and integration with more renewable energy sources.
